Understanding Accident Injury Law

Accident injury law, likewise known as personal injury law, covers a variety of scenarios where somebody suffers harm due to another celebration's carelessness. The main objective of this law is to supply relief to the injured party and prevent the negligent habits that caused the injury in the very first place.

Types of Accident Injury Cases

Accident injury cases can be categorized into several types. Table 1 below highlights a few of the most common types:

Type of AccidentDescription
Motor Vehicle AccidentsInjuries arising from car, truck, motorbike, or bus accidents.
Slip and Fall AccidentsInjuries occurring on somebody else's residential or commercial property due to hazardous conditions.
Workplace InjuriesInjuries sustained while carrying out occupational tasks.
Medical MalpracticeInjuries arising from a health care supplier's neglect or misbehavior.
Product LiabilityInjuries triggered by faulty or hazardous items.
Pet BitesInjuries stemming from a canine attack or bite, typically including liability problems.

The Role of an Accident Injury Case Lawyer

Accident injury lawyers concentrate on representing people who have been hurt in accidents due to another celebration's negligence. Their duties include a variety of jobs targeted at ensuring customers receive the compensation they should have. Below is an extensive list of what these lawyers do:

  1. Initial Consultation: They carry out assessments of cases to identify if there is a valid claim.

  2. Gathering Evidence: They gather needed documentation, such as cops reports, medical records, and witness statements.

  3. Working Out with Insurance Companies: They deal with interaction with insurance service providers to work out reasonable settlements for their clients.

  4. Developing a Case: They develop a strong case by recognizing liability, evaluating damages, and providing evidence.

  5. Filing Lawsuits: If settlements fail, they file suits on behalf of customers and represent them in court.

  6. Offering Legal Advice: They offer guidance throughout the whole process, making sure customers comprehend their rights and alternatives.

  7. Representing Clients in Court: In cases that go to trial, accident injury legal representatives promote for their clients, providing proof and arguments to support their case.

The Process of Hiring an Accident Injury Lawyer

Finding the ideal lawyer can feel difficult. Here's a step-by-step process to streamline the employing procedure:

  1. Research: Look for legal representatives with experience in personal injury cases similar to yours.

  2. Assessments: Many legal representatives provide complimentary consultations. Utilize this as an opportunity to ask questions and evaluate compatibility.

  3. Assess Experience: Review their case history and success rates, including trial and settlement outcomes.

  4. Talk about Fees: Understand their charge structure and any extra costs that might develop.

  5. Evaluation Contracts: Read through the representation arrangement and clarify any uncertain terms before finalizing.

  6. Establish Communication: Ensure you have a clear line of communication and understand how frequently to expect updates on your case.

How long do I have to sue?

The statute of restrictions differs by state but typically ranges from one to 3 years from the date of the accident. It is vital to speak with a lawyer immediately to secure your rights.

What if the accident was partly my fault?

The majority of states follow a relative negligence rule, indicating you can still recover damages even if you were partially at fault. The compensation may be decreased based upon your level of responsibility.

How much does it cost to hire an accident injury lawyer?

Most personal injury attorneys deal with a contingency cost basis, typically taking 25% to 40% of the final settlement or award. Always clarify fees during your initial consultation.
